About Sober Living Homes in Redmond, OR

Finding a stable, supportive environment after treatment is a critical step in recovery. For those in Redmond, Oregon, a sober living home provides that bridge between a structured program and independent life. Redmond’s close-knit community and slower pace can be a real asset, offering a quieter setting to focus on healing. However, like many growing Central Oregon towns, Redmond also faces challenges with housing costs and limited local recovery resources, making a safe, sober residence an even more valuable option for maintaining long-term stability.

Anyone leaving a treatment program—or simply seeking a fresh start away from old triggers—can benefit from the accountability and peer support a sober living home provides. These homes offer a drug- and alcohol-free environment where you can rebuild routines, find employment, and reconnect with family. Whether you’re new to Redmond or a long-time resident, the structure of a sober living home helps you practice real-world skills while surrounded by others who share your commitment to recovery. It’s a practical, hopeful step toward building a life you’re proud to live.

What is the difference between sober living and rehab?

Rehab provides active treatment including therapy and medical care. Sober living homes provide structured housing with rules and accountability but residents manage their own treatment and daily schedules. Many people transition from rehab to sober living.

How much do sober living homes cost?

Costs vary widely by location and amenities. Monthly fees typically range from $500 to $5,000 or more. Some homes accept insurance or offer financial assistance. Contact facilities directly for current pricing.
